Uk Driving Licence Update

I think, but can't be sure that when we came to live here in 2007 I changed our Licence addresses to my sons house. However the licences that we have show our old address in the UK.

Looking today I see that the Valid until date on my licence is sometime last year ... guess that is to renew the photo as I'm only 67 years old and my licence should be valid until I'm 70.

My wifes licence is valid until sometime in 2014 ... again I guess for photo change.

I'm not sure that I will want to drive again in the UK but I may.

As I'm Non Resident and Not Ordinary Resident could I use either my Thai Licence or an International Driving Permit if I needed to drive in the UK whilst say on holiday?

What have others done about their UK driving licence address ...

I found out earlier this year that whilst my licence is valid until I am 70, the photo has a ten year life span, therefore as I was going home this summer I renewed my licence via my daughters address and gave them my passport number which they used to download my photo from the Foreign Office, the passport has to be under five years old, there was a £20 charge. The new licence is valid until I am 70
